Bulldogs Fall In NWCA National Duals

DES MOINES – The Bulldog Wrestling team dropped a trio of matches at the National Wrestling Coaches Association Division II National Duals on Saturday. Senior Ryan Maus was the lone Bulldog to win all three of his matches on the day.
 
Truman returns to conference action on Friday when they travel to the University of Central Missouri.
 
#7 Kutztown (Pa.) 24, Truman 18
It came down to the final match but in the end, the top-ranked wrestler at 284 and all-American from last year, Ziad Haddad pinned Ben Dudley in the first period to give Kutztown the 24-18 victory over the Bulldogs.
 
Jabez Zinabu got things started with a 6-3 win for Truman but Brandon Davis matched the score with a 6-5 victory over Rafael Lopez at 133.
 
Mitch Voelker pinned Andrew Still at 141 but Truman's All-American' Ryan Maus answered with his own pin to keep the dual tied at nine points apiece.
 
Devon Fenstermaker put Truman back on top with a second period pin at 165 but the Golden Bears leap frogged over Truman with a 6-1 decision at 174 and 2-0 win at 184.
 
Helmut Rentschler set up the winner-takes-all bout with a 5-2 decision over Brandan Clark at 197.
 
The loss sent Truman into the consolation bracket of the National Duals.

Colorado-Pueblo 20, Truman 16
 
Truman trailed 7-0 before Andrew Still and Ryan Maus scored nine team points for the Bulldogs to take the lead. Still got an injury default win for six points and Maus was a 7-1 winner over Jimmy Chase.
 
Fenstermaker put Truman back in front with a 9-1 major win at 165 and Ryan Ward lifted Truman on top after they fell behind with a 4-2 decision at 184.
 
CSU-Pueblo won the final two matches to take the dual. Riley Argyle won 5-1 over Rentschler and All-American and nationally-ranked Niko Bogojevic defeated Dudley 6-0 at 285.

Wisconsin-Parkside 35, Truman 7
 
In the final match of the National Duals, Truman was downed by the Wisconsin-Parkside Rangers 35-7.
 
Ryan Maus and Colton Schmitz picked up the lone wins for the Bulldogs with Maus winning 14-2 and Schmitz taking the 157 match 6-4.
